    My husband and I will be coming to WDW in May 2013 with our six year old and twin two years old. We will be outnumbered 3 to 2. So I was wondering if we would still be able to ride the kiddie rides together, or will we somehow have to take turns riding?

    Hi Natalie,

    My family has the exact same configuration as yours, twins plus a child a few years older. We made several successful trips to Walt Disney World when they were all preschoolers. 

    You will have no problem at all with the vast majority of the kiddie rides at Walt Disney World. For example, the hunny pot vehicles in the Winnie the Pooh ride fit five people. The Small World boats fit about 20 people, four or five per row. The Dumbo elephants are a tight squeeze, but I fit into a car with my twins when they were two.

    There is a complete run down on this topic on the independent website blog.touringplans.com. Search there for an article called "Avoiding the Odd Man Out." You'll be reassured that you won't have an issue with the odd number of people in your family.
